Course Details

  • Energy Policy and Regulation: Understanding the legal and regulatory framework that governs the energy sector, including clean energy policies and regulations at the local, national, and international levels.
  • Climate Science and Energy: Exploring the relationship between climate change and energy production, including the science behind renewable and non-renewable energy sources, and their environmental impact.
  • Energy Economics and Finance: Examining the economic and financial aspects of the energy sector, including energy markets, pricing, and investment opportunities in clean energy.
  • Energy Technology and Innovation: Investigating the latest technological advancements and innovations in the energy sector, including renewable energy technologies, energy storage, and smart grids.
  • Energy Advocacy and Communication: Learning effective communication strategies for energy advocacy, including how to engage with stakeholders, build public support, and influence energy policy.
  • Ethics and Journalism: Examining the ethical considerations for journalists reporting on energy and climate change, including objectivity, accuracy, and fairness.
  • Data Analysis and Visualization: Developing skills in data analysis and visualization to effectively communicate complex energy issues to a general audience.
  • Crisis Communication and Risk Management: Understanding the role of journalists in communicating crisis situations and managing risks associated with energy production and climate change.
